Aftercare Planning Starts During Your Stay

We don’t wait until your final days to think about aftercare—planning begins early in your residential program. Your clinical team works with you throughout your stay to identify potential triggers and challenges you’ll face when you return home, whether that’s work stress, relationship dynamics, or environmental factors.

Together, we develop practical strategies for managing these challenges, from coping techniques to communication skills to lifestyle adjustments. We help you build a support network including therapists, support groups, and trusted friends or family members who can support your continued recovery. We also connect you with local resources in your area, ensuring you have access to quality ongoing care close to home.

By the time you leave Aston Private, you’ll have a detailed, personalised aftercare plan that outlines exactly what you need to do to maintain your progress and who to contact if you need help.

Comprehensive Ongoing Support

Your integrated aftercare program provides multiple layers of support designed to keep you on track and help you navigate challenges as they arise.

Regular follow-up sessions with your Aston Private clinical team allow you to check in on your progress, discuss any difficulties you’re facing, and adjust your recovery plan as needed. These sessions can be conducted via telehealth for your convenience.

Crisis support ensures that if you’re struggling or facing a potential relapse situation, you can reach our team immediately for guidance and intervention. You’re never alone in your recovery journey.

Medication management support continues for those who require psychiatric medications, with coordination between our psychiatrists and your local providers to ensure continuity of care and appropriate monitoring.

Recovery mentor access keeps you connected to your personal recovery mentor who understands your journey and can provide peer support, encouragement, and accountability during difficult moments.

Navigating Real-World Challenges

The first weeks and months after leaving residential treatment require careful attention and support. You’re implementing new coping strategies in environments where old patterns and triggers still exist. This is where aftercare becomes essential.

We help you establish healthy routines that support your recovery, from sleep hygiene to exercise to stress management practices. You’ll learn to recognise warning signs that you might be struggling and know exactly what steps to take before problems escalate. We support you in rebuilding relationships with family, friends, and colleagues in healthy, boundaried ways.

Work reintegration receives special attention for our executive and professional clients. We help you manage workplace stress, set appropriate boundaries, and maintain the balance you’ve worked so hard to achieve while meeting your professional responsibilities.

Throughout this transition, your aftercare team provides guidance, celebrates your successes, and helps you course-correct when needed. Recovery isn’t linear, and we’re there for the ups and downs.
